What is a Loan License?
A loan license is given to companies who wish to manufacture drugs using the facilities of another manufacturer with a (valid and current) manufacturing license from the applicable Drug Control Administration. In short, you do not have to own/operate a pharmaceutical manufacturing operation; you can utilize the existing (approved) & licensed pharmaceutical manufacturing facility (under your brand name) already in place.
The loan license is a very valuable option, especially for those companies that are looking to establish themselves in the pharmaceuticals industry. This would include those in the startup, pharma marketer, and wholesale/distribution portion of the industry. The advantage of this model is that an organization can launch their pharmaceutical products without having to invest in the land, machinery, and infrastructure required to build their own factories.
The host manufacturer has all of the necessary regulatory approvals, technical staff, and infrastructure already established. The holder of the loan license can then concentrate their efforts on product planning/branding, marketing, and distribution of the product.

Obtain Loan License:
Loan licenses are handled by the applicant company together with the licensed manufacturer's unit, submitting the necessary documents/ forms to the licensing authority or State Drug Controller. The loan license process consists of:
- Finding a licensed manufacturer who issues loan licenses.
- Creating an agreement for the loan license between the applicant and the manufacturer.
- Assembling all required documents.
- Submitting the loan license application to the licensing authority for processing.
- If required, inspection/verification by the licensing authority.
- Upon receipt of the loan license/approval and confirming compliance, manufacturing may commence.
In some instances, applications must be filed on prescribed forms with applicable fees/ undertakings, and it is critical to ascertain that the host facility is approved to manufacture the exact type of drug being manufactured.
Common Documentation Needs
While the specific documents required for each state and product category vary, there are many recognized commonality among the different lists of required documents. Some of these common documents that you may be required to provide may include:
Documentation of incorporation of the applicant company.
- PAN, GST.
- Identification and address proof for the directors/partners.
- Loan licensing agreement with the manufacturer of the product.
- List of proposed products being developed or manufactured.
- Details about technical staff.
- Site Master File / Manufacturing Arrangement Details.
- Copy of the Host Manufacturing License.
- Product Permissions / Technical Compliance documentation.
- Undertakings/Statutory Forms required by the Authority.
If the manufacturing facility produces specialized products, then you may need to provide additional Technical Compliance documentation. Therefore, prior to applying, it is advisable that you prepare all of the subject materials in advance so that there are no delays.

Important Things to Do Before Submitting Your Application
Check the License of Your Host Facility
Confirm the facility where your product will be manufactured has the appropriate license for the product type.
Check for GMP & Quality Compliance
Verify that the facility meets all current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and your product's quality specifications.
Read the Agreement Carefully
Review the terms and conditions of your agreement with the contract manufacturer so you understand your obligations.
Check for Appropriate Documentation & Approvals
Request a list of all required documentation and approvals before submitting your application to avoid any application delays and potential denial of your application.
Review Expected Delivery Times
Understand what the expected lead times are to get your product manufactured and delivered to you.
Understand Your Responsibilities for Labeling & Packaging
Understand who will be responsible for the labeling and packaging of the final product and your obligations for any batch release procedures required by the FDA or other regulatory agencies.
These considerations are essential because non-compliance with FDA regulations may cause delays in your application or result in its rejection.
